<p>So anyways, to briefly summarize the plot:  it&#8217;s about a father and his young son traveling a road to nowhere in a future dying world with murderous cannibalizing gangs, and a lack of food and shelter as constant sources of danger and fear.  Occasionally they encounter some other world-weary traveler and the boy always wants to help them and give them the benefit of the doubt, while the father is convinced that &#8220;the good guys&#8221; are nowhere to be found.</p>
<p>To me, the road they&#8217;re on is a metaphor for life.  I mean, you can spend your entire life constantly being afraid of what&#8217;s around the bend, not trusting anyone or putting down roots anywhere like the father, (who has his child&#8217;s best interest at heart&#8211;he&#8217;s seen the evil in the world.)  But really &#8211; what kind of life is that?  Or you can take a chance on someone and not expect the worst and see what happens.</p>
<p>I was certain this book was going to have a horribly depressing ending, (like them both roasting on a spit or something) but ultimately I was surprised.  The picture is still bleak at the end, but there&#8217;s hope.  Sometimes that&#8217;s all you need, right?</p>
